Description Dario Castellarin 2012-08-22 20:42:00 UTC
Description of problem:
I was just trying to authenticate by swiping my finger on the UPEK fignerprint reader, however the authentication window got stuck and I had to about it.

Version-Release number of selected component:
fprintd-0.4.1-2.fc17

Additional info:
libreport version: 2.0.13
abrt_version:   2.0.11
backtrace_rating: 3
cmdline:        /usr/libexec/fprintd
kernel:         3.5.2-3.fc17.x86_64

truncated backtrace:
:Thread no. 1 (10 frames)
: #0 ??
: #1 usbi_handle_transfer_completion at io.c
: #2 handle_control_completion at os/linux_usbfs.c
: #3 reap_for_handle at os/linux_usbfs.c
: #4 op_handle_events at os/linux_usbfs.c
: #5 handle_events at io.c
: #6 libusb_handle_events_timeout_completed at io.c
: #7 libusb_handle_events_timeout at io.c
: #8 fp_handle_events_timeout at poll.c
: #9 source_dispatch at main.c
